In a nutshell, I want my JQuery UI Slider to look like this:
3asdfsdasdf

Is there a way to only color the left half of the slider and then adjust it’s color when it slides either way?

    The image showed up fine for me.

    Here’s some css to style the background of the slider (which only colors the left side).

    #idOfSlider .ui-slider-range { background: #ef2929; }
    

    To adjust it’s color:

    function refresh()
    {
      $('#idOfSlider').find('.ui-slider-range').css('background-color', 'red');
    }
    
    $( "#idOfSlider" ).slider({
       range: 'min',
       slide: refresh,
       change: refresh
    });
